This document describes ways parents can help teens after disasters. It gives tips for talking about feelings like guilt, fear, and anger. Parents should listen, explain that these feelings are normal, and set safe limits. It suggests keeping routines, staying connected with family and friends, watching for risky behaviors like drinking or acting out, and encouraging helpful activities. Parents are advised to be patient with changes in mood or attitude and to avoid big life decisions right after a disaster. The guide also reminds parents to take care of their own emotions during recovery.
